Public Site Exposes Personal Data of Millions, EIN and License Plates, PSafe Alert

The dfndr lab, PSafe‘s laboratory specializing in digital security, discovered a public website where it would be possible to access around 426 million instances of personal data, including as many as 109 million Employer Identification Numbers (EIN) and license plates, in Brazil.